Extracting Dna From Strawberries Worksheet
Extracting Dna From Strawberries Worksheet - In this fun activity, you’ll get to see dna from a strawberry using stuff you can find at home. Dna is present in every cell of plants and animals. Pull off any green leaves on the strawberry. We will use an extraction buffer containing salt to break up protein chains that bind around the nucleic acids and dish soap to dissolve the lipid (fat) part. Put the strawberries into the plastic bag, seal it and gently smash the strawberries for about two minutes. It’s a neat way to see something that’s usually too tiny.
